Markus Klien
Profile
Markus Klien is an Austrian politician and member of the Freedom Party of Austria (FPÖ). Since November 2024, he has served as a member of the Vorarlberg Landtag. In addition to his legislative duties, he has been a member of the Hohenems city council since 2010 and assumed the role of Deputy Mayor of Hohenems in 2025. Prior to his full-time political career, Klien worked as a Director of Global Maintenance Management at ThyssenKrupp Presta AG. He holds a degree in Business Project and Process Management from the Vorarlberg University of Applied Sciences.
